- Assesses patient health by interviewing patients, performing physical examinations, and identifying medical and surgical conditions.

- Obtains, updates, and studies patient medical and surgical histories.

- Provides continuity of care by developing and implementing patient management plans.

- Determines abnormalities by ordering and/or administering appropriate diagnostic tests, such as X-rays, electrocardiograms, and laboratory studies.

- Reviews and interprets patient test results.

- Provides pre- and post-operative care and patient education.

- Performs therapeutic procedures by administering injections, suturing, managing drains, dressing changes, wound care, and infection management in both the clinic and hospital settings.

- Performs hospital rounds on surgical consultations, pre- and post-operative hospital patients.

- Performs and/or assists the supervising physician with discharge services including discharge planning, discharge summaries, and coordinating post-discharge follow-up care.

- Serves as surgical first-assist during operating procedures.

- Lifts, holds, positions patients, and stands during extended periods of time in the operating room.

- Performs surgical skin closures, suturing, and related operative care.

- Helps facilitate smooth workflows in both the clinic and operating room settings.

- Performs hospital on-call services in support of the supervising physician on-call, including both weekdays and weekends over 24-hour periods.

- Assists in emergency care services directly related to the surgical specialty including consultations and surgical procedures.

- Instructs and counsels patients and relatives as appropriate.

- Documents patient care services by appropriately charting in the patient and department records.
